    NJ Shore Report for August 1: High Rip Current Risk, Rough Surf and Boating Advisory Issued

    Visitors heading to New Jersey beaches today should prepare for dangerous surf, strong rip currents and rough marine conditions as officials urge swimmers and boaters to exercise caution.

    High Rip Current Risk Along the Jersey Shore

    People planning to visit the Jersey Shore on Saturday, August 1, are being advised to stay careful because dangerous ocean conditions are continuing along the New Jersey coast.

    The latest Jersey Shore Report says that the risk of rip currents is very high. These strong currents can quickly pull swimmers away from the shore, especially at beaches where lifeguards are not present. Officials are asking everyone to swim only at beaches with lifeguards on duty.

    Rough Surf and Strong Winds Expected

    The weather forecast includes:

    • High rip current risk

    • Waves of 3 to 6 feet

    • Northeast winds between 20 and 28 mph, with stronger gusts at times

    • Rough and choppy surf conditions throughout the day

    Because of these conditions, swimming, surfing and paddle boarding could become dangerous.

    Boaters Asked to Be Careful

    A Small Craft Advisory is also in effect. Strong winds and rough seas can create problems for small boats. Authorities say that inexperienced boaters should avoid going into open waters until conditions improve.

    Safety Advice for Beach Visitors

    Officials are sharing several important safety tips:

    • Swim only where lifeguards are present.

    • Do not swim alone.

    • If you are caught in a rip current, stay calm and float.

    • Swim parallel to the shore until you are out of the current.

    • Boaters should check the latest marine forecast before leaving.

    Check Conditions Before You Go

    Many people are expected to visit New Jersey beaches this weekend despite the rough surf. Officials recommend checking weather, tide and ocean forecasts before traveling to the shore.

    Beach visitors are also encouraged to follow warning flags and listen to lifeguards and local authorities throughout the day to stay safe.
